When i first published my site www.ridentherockies.com (http://www.ridentherockies.com) my links to the horses for sale to the specific pages worked fine. I added more pages with other horses, published it again and they do not work. I checked the names on the pages and they look correct, what else could it be?

well it is the way you have made your links. here is the first 4 links:
http://www.ridentherockies.com/APHA.html (http://www.ridentherockies.com/APHA.html)
even though this link works, you should have no caps, no spaces in your saved pages
http://www.ridentherockies.com/aqha.html (http://www.ridentherockies.com/aqha.html)
this one seems to be perfect
http://www.rideintherockies.com/freckleshtml (http://www.rideintherockies.com/freckleshtml)
this one yu have ride(i)where number 2 has no (i)
this has the same problem as number 3

i know you have watched the video tutorials endless times, but accuracy is upmost importance when building a website. take your time and make sure the link is correct. Blue Voda never is wrong, so when something doesnt work, it's because you made a mistake. After all we are all human.\
hope this helps

duh, i was so engrossed in the page specific part of the name that i didnt look at the url part